KM10 LLC is a 2010 Kia Proceed in Grey with a 1,582c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 7 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.
Across all 2010 Kia Proceed models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.5% with a typical mileage of 67,540 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Kia Proceed f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 555 recorded failures. If you're considering buying KM10 LLC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Kia Proceed typically stays on UK roads for around 18 years. At 16 years old, this Kia Proceed is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
